Got in a 5 year old Samsung 1080p plasma TV last weekend with 3 other flat screens. Was told that one of the set smokes. I thought the guy said that it was a 32" set that I got in. It didn't smoke. I then forgot about that comment.


Today I plugged the Samsung in. It seemed to work fine, so I ran downstairs to get a programmable remote for it. I came back up, the set is still working fine.

However.. I smell something burning. I look on my bench to see what I'd put the soldering gun or iron on to cause the smell. I glance over at the still working Samsung. Smoke is POURING out the back. I knew right away what the problem was. It was an easy 15 minute fix.

It was indeed the main power supply caps. One went from 470uF to 200pF, and the other was at about 150uF. What got me is that one was so hot, you couldn't touch it, yet the set kept working. Robbed caps off another working power supply board, and it's running fine. No more smell!
